Introduction: What is Web Application Hosting?
Web application hosting is the process of providing the necessary infrastructure and services to make a web application accessible over the internet. This involves operating servers, storing and managing data, and enabling users to access the application through their web browsers. The choice of hosting type is a decisive factor based on the needs of the business.
Types of Web Hosting
Web hosting types can generally be divided into three main categories:
- Shared Hosting: This model hosts multiple websites on the same server. It is cost-effective but offers limited resources and performance.
- VPS (Virtual Private Server): This model, known as a virtual private server, is created by partitioning a physical server into virtual sections. It offers more control, customization, and security.
- Dedicated Server: These are servers fully allocated to a single business. They provide the highest performance and control but come at a higher cost.

VPS Hosting: Advantages and Disadvantages
VPS hosting offers more control and customization options, but it also comes with higher costs.
Control and Customization
VPS hosting provides users with full control over the server. This is a significant advantage for customizing the application according to its needs.
Security and Performance
VPS hosting offers better security and performance compared to shared hosting. Users benefit from higher speed and security as they do not share resources with other users.

Shared or VPS? Which Option is More Suitable?
Shared Hosting for Startups
For new companies, shared hosting may be an attractive option due to its low cost. However, it should be noted that this system may become inadequate as growth begins.
Transition to VPS for Growing Companies
As a company starts to grow and requires more resources and security, it should transition to VPS hosting. This shift provides performance improvements and a better user experience.
